Home
last modified time | relevance | path

Searched refs:mappable (Results 1 – 25 of 38) sorted by relevance

12

/third_party/mesa3d/src/intel/dev/
Dintel_dev_info.c54 if (devinfo->mem.sram.mappable.size > 0 || in print_regions_info()
62 devinfo->mem.sram.mappable.size); in print_regions_info()
64 devinfo->mem.sram.mappable.free); in print_regions_info()
73 if (devinfo->mem.vram.mappable.size > 0 || in print_regions_info()
81 devinfo->mem.vram.mappable.size); in print_regions_info()
83 devinfo->mem.vram.mappable.free); in print_regions_info()
Dintel_device_info.c1614 devinfo->mem.sram.mappable.size = mem->probed_size; in query_regions()
1618 assert(devinfo->mem.sram.mappable.size == mem->probed_size); in query_regions()
1625 devinfo->mem.sram.mappable.free = MIN2(available, mem->probed_size); in query_regions()
1633 devinfo->mem.vram.mappable.size = mem->probed_cpu_visible_size; in query_regions()
1641 devinfo->mem.vram.mappable.size = mem->probed_size; in query_regions()
1647 assert((devinfo->mem.vram.mappable.size + in query_regions()
1652 devinfo->mem.vram.mappable.free = mem->unallocated_cpu_visible_size; in query_regions()
1662 devinfo->mem.vram.mappable.free = mem->unallocated_size; in query_regions()
1688 devinfo->mem.sram.mappable.size = total_phys; in compute_system_memory()
1690 assert(devinfo->mem.sram.mappable.size == total_phys); in compute_system_memory()
[all …]
Dintel_device_info.h416 } mappable, unmappable; member
/third_party/libdrm/intel/
Dintel_bufmgr.c364 drm_intel_get_aperture_sizes(int fd, size_t *mappable, size_t *total) in drm_intel_get_aperture_sizes() argument
374 *mappable = 0; in drm_intel_get_aperture_sizes()
376 if (*mappable == 0) in drm_intel_get_aperture_sizes()
377 *mappable = drm_intel_probe_agp_aperture_size(fd); in drm_intel_get_aperture_sizes()
378 if (*mappable == 0) in drm_intel_get_aperture_sizes()
379 *mappable = 64 * 1024 * 1024; /* minimum possible value */ in drm_intel_get_aperture_sizes()
Dintel_bufmgr.h215 int drm_intel_get_aperture_sizes(int fd, size_t *mappable, size_t *total);
/third_party/skia/third_party/externals/dawn/src/dawn_native/vulkan/
DResourceMemoryAllocatorVk.cpp233 bool mappable = kind == MemoryKind::LinearMappable; in FindBestTypeIndex() local
244 if (mappable && in FindBestTypeIndex()
250 if (mappable && in FindBestTypeIndex()
266 if (!mappable && (currentDeviceLocal != bestDeviceLocal)) { in FindBestTypeIndex()
/third_party/skia/third_party/externals/dawn/src/dawn_wire/client/
DBuffer.cpp28 bool mappable = in Create() local
31 if (mappable && descriptor->size >= std::numeric_limits<size_t>::max()) { in Create()
47 if (mappable) { in Create()
/third_party/mesa3d/src/virtio/vulkan/
Dvn_renderer_virtgpu.c714 bool mappable) in virtgpu_ioctl_prime_handle_to_fd() argument
718 .flags = DRM_CLOEXEC | (mappable ? DRM_RDWR : 0), in virtgpu_ioctl_prime_handle_to_fd()
1107 const bool mappable = bo->blob_flags & VIRTGPU_BLOB_FLAG_USE_MAPPABLE; in virtgpu_bo_map() local
1110 if (!bo->base.mmap_ptr && mappable) { in virtgpu_bo_map()
1124 const bool mappable = bo->blob_flags & VIRTGPU_BLOB_FLAG_USE_MAPPABLE; in virtgpu_bo_export_dma_buf() local
1128 ? virtgpu_ioctl_prime_handle_to_fd(gpu, bo->gem_handle, mappable) in virtgpu_bo_export_dma_buf()
Dvn_renderer_vtest.c676 const bool mappable = bo->blob_flags & VCMD_BLOB_FLAG_MAPPABLE; in vtest_bo_map() local
680 if (!bo->base.mmap_ptr && mappable) { in vtest_bo_map()
/third_party/skia/third_party/externals/opengl-registry/extensions/ARB/
DARB_sparse_buffer.txt225 extension, we disallow creation of a mappable sparse buffer, which in
237 2 4/17/2014 gsellers Make it illegal to create a mappable sparse
/third_party/openGLES/extensions/ARB/
DARB_sparse_buffer.txt235 extension, we disallow creation of a mappable sparse buffer, which in
247 2 4/17/2014 gsellers Make it illegal to create a mappable sparse
/third_party/vk-gl-cts/external/vulkan-docs/src/appendices/
DVK_EXT_host_image_copy.adoc58 Most importantly, the device memory may not be mappable by an application,
DVK_ANDROID_external_memory_android_hardware_buffer.adoc93 usage be mappable in Vulkan? Should it be possible to export an
DVK_ANDROID_external_memory_android_hardware_buffer.txt93 usage be mappable in Vulkan? Should it be possible to export an
/third_party/openGLES/extensions/NV/
DNV_memory_attachment.txt390 3) Do we support client-mappable resources?
392 RESOLVED: Yes. Client-mappable resources are supported but not
/third_party/skia/third_party/externals/icu/source/data/mappings/
Dgsm-03.38-2009.ucm33 # not mappable in the standard.)
/third_party/icu/icu4c/source/data/mappings/
Dgsm-03.38-2009.ucm33 # not mappable in the standard.)
/third_party/mesa3d/src/intel/vulkan/
Danv_device.c383 anv_compute_sys_heap_size(device, devinfo->mem.sram.mappable.size); in anv_init_meminfo()
384 device->sys.available = devinfo->mem.sram.mappable.free; in anv_init_meminfo()
389 device->vram_mappable.size = devinfo->mem.vram.mappable.size; in anv_init_meminfo()
390 device->vram_mappable.available = devinfo->mem.vram.mappable.free; in anv_init_meminfo()
409 device->sys.available = devinfo->mem.sram.mappable.free; in anv_update_meminfo()
410 device->vram_mappable.available = devinfo->mem.vram.mappable.free; in anv_update_meminfo()
/third_party/mesa3d/docs/gallium/
Dresources.rst22 D3D11: D3D11 lacks transfers, but has special resource types that are mappable to the CPU address s…
/third_party/mesa3d/src/gallium/drivers/iris/
Diris_bufmgr.c2349 bufmgr->sys.size = devinfo->mem.sram.mappable.size; in iris_bufmgr_get_meminfo()
2353 bufmgr->vram.size = devinfo->mem.vram.mappable.size; in iris_bufmgr_get_meminfo()
/third_party/icu/docs/userguide/conversion/
Ddata.md163 icu/source/tools/makeconv). The makeconv tool writes one binary, memory-mappable
/third_party/skia/third_party/externals/opengl-registry/extensions/EXT/
DEXT_external_objects.txt957 12) Should buffer objects backed by memory objects be mappable?
/third_party/openGLES/extensions/EXT/
DEXT_external_objects.txt985 12) Should buffer objects backed by memory objects be mappable?
/third_party/icu/docs/userguide/dev/
Dcodingguidelines.md2010 Each field in a binary/mappable data format must be aligned naturally. This
2044 binary/mappable data in C++, assert in some place in the code that `offsetof` the
/third_party/ffmpeg/doc/
Dindevs.texi964 This will only work if the framebuffer is both linear and mappable - if not, the result

12